HWNIX vs. GQJPX
Compare and contrast key facts about Hotchkis & Wiley International Value Fund (HWNIX) and GQG Partners International Quality Dividend Income Fund (GQJPX).
HWNIX is managed by Hotchkis & Wiley. It was launched on Dec 30, 2015. GQJPX is managed by GQG Partners Inc. It was launched on Jun 29, 2021.

Correlation
The correlation between HWNIX and GQJPX is 0.76, which is considered to be high. That indicates a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Having highly-correlated positions in a portfolio may signal a lack of diversification, potentially leading to increased risk during market downturns.
